Philip Eugene Sufficool 1921 - 1967

Philip Eugene Sufficool of St Joseph County, Indiana United States was born on September 14, 1921 in South Bend, St. Joseph County, and died at age 46 years old on September 26, 1967 in Los Angeles, Los Angeles County, CA. Philip Sufficool was buried at Green Hills LA 27501 S Western Ave, in Rancho Palos Verdes.

  • Ethnicity & Family History

    Philip Eugene Sufficool was born to parents Roy August Sufficool and Laurene M Blesh. He was white. His mother Laurene was born in December of 1900 in Nebraska and grew up in Oakdale, Antelope, Nebraska. She married Roy in 1920 and the couple lived in Roseland, St Joseph, Indiana and South Bend; Mishawaka, Indiana, USA where she worked as an inspector at Bendix. She passed away on October 26, 1964 in Los Angeles CA. His father Roy was born on September 25, 1895 in Seneca, Kansas. He lived with his wife and kids in Roseland, St Joseph, Indiana, USA and Mishawaka, Indiana, USA where he worked for the telephone company. He passed away on September 28, 1965 in Los Angeles County, California, USA.
  • Early Life & Education

    Roy had a brother named August Dale Sufficool (1924-1991). He completed four years of high school.
  • Military Service

    Military serial#: 35339398 Enlisted: September 8, 1942 in Toledo Ohio Military branch: Branch Immaterial - Warrant Officers, Usa Rank: Private, Selectees (enlisted Men) Terms of enlistment: Enlistment For The Duration Of The War Or Other Emergency, Plus Six Months, Subject To The Discretion Of The President Or Otherwise According To Law
  • Professional Career

    Semiskilled Linemen And Servicemen, Telegraph, Telephone, And Power
  • Personal Life & Family

    On May 4, 1942 Phillip married Fairy Dawn Wilson (1924–1987) in Indiana, United States. The couple were parents to Fairy Dawn Sufficool Clifton (1946-2019) and Craig Eugene Sufficool (1950-2021). In the 1960's, he was a registered Republican voter in Los Angeles, California, USA.
